A single coil with a radius of 0.02 m is placed inside a 3m longsolenoid that has 600 turns. The radius of the solenoid is 0.15 m.The plane of the coil is perpendicular to the axis of the solenoid.The solenoid is connected to a battery, an ammeter and a switch.The ammeter reaches 5A in 0.2 seconds and remains constant.

a) What is the change in the magnetic flux across the small loop?
b) What is the average induced emf (voltage) in the small loop?
c) Another solenoid has an inductance of 8.000 henries and aresistance of 2.772Ω. It is connected to a battery and aswitch. How long does it take for the current toreach half of itsmaximum value after the switch is closed?
